Barbi Benton - American Model and Actress
Barbi Benton, a stunning and talented American model and actress, captivated the hearts of many during the 1970s and 1980s. With her striking beauty, infectious charm, and multi-faceted talent, she became a beloved figure in the entertainment industry. Benton's journey to stardom is as fascinating as her career itself. From gracing the pages of Playboy magazine to making memorable appearances on hit television shows, her impact reached far and wide, making her an icon of her time.
Born on January 28, 1950, in New York City as Barbara Lynn Klein, Barbi Benton had a natural affinity for the spotlight from a young age. Her journey in the entertainment industry began when she caught the attention of Playboy founder Hugh Hefner in 1968, leading to her being the magazine's cover model at the tender age of 18. This catapulted her into the public eye, and Benton soon became one of the publication's most recognizable faces. With her magnetic allure and stunning beauty, she quickly gained a legion of loyal fans.
While her success as a model was undeniable, Benton's true passion lay in pursuing an acting career. She made her television debut in 1969 on the popular variety show "Rowan & Martin's Laugh-In," which brought her wider recognition and introduced her to a broader audience. With her quick wit, comedic timing, and undeniable talent, Benton quickly became a fan favorite and was able to showcase her versatility as a performer.
Benton's acting career soared to new heights with her role as the seductive sidekick to private investigator Ken Berry on the hit television series "Hee Haw." The show, which blended comedy and country music, provided Benton with a platform to showcase her acting skills while embracing her love for music. Her performances on "Hee Haw," whether through her singing or comedic sketches, further solidified her status as a rising star in the entertainment industry.
In addition to her television roles, Benton also made a name for herself on the big screen. She appeared in several popular films, including "The Third Girl from the Left" and "Hospital Massacre," where she showcased her range as an actress. Benton's on-screen presence was magnetic, and her performances were often hailed for their depth and authenticity.
Beyond her success in modeling and acting, Benton's personal life also garnered much attention. She had a long-standing relationship with Playboy founder Hugh Hefner, which spanned over eight years. Despite their breakup, Benton maintained a strong connection with Hefner and contributed to the continued success of Playboy magazine long after her time as a model. In addition to her relationship with Hefner, Benton embarked on a romance with businessman George Gradow, whom she married in 1979. They share two children, and their marriage has stood the test of time, lasting over four decades.
